1. Is a computer screen or other screen that you can touch with your finger to enter information.

Explanation

A touch screen is a computer screen or other screen that can be operated by touching it with your finger to enter information. This technology allows users to interact directly with the screen, eliminating the need for a keyboard or mouse. Touch screens are commonly used in smartphones, tablets, and other electronic devices to provide a more intuitive and user-friendly interface.

2. Gives you sound output from your computer.

Explanation

Speakers are devices that produce sound output from a computer. They receive audio signals from the computer and convert them into sound waves that can be heard by the user. Unlike printers, USB, and CD/DVD drives, speakers are specifically designed for audio output and are essential for listening to music, watching videos, or hearing any other type of audio on a computer.

3. An Operating System is a computer program that manages the resources of a computer.

Explanation

An operating system is a crucial software that controls and coordinates the various hardware and software components of a computer system. It manages resources such as memory, processor, input/output devices, and file systems, ensuring their efficient allocation and utilization. Without an operating system, the computer would not be able to perform tasks or run applications effectively. Therefore, the statement "An Operating System is a computer program that manages the resources of a computer" is true.

4. A way to input letters or numbers into different applications or programs.

Explanation

A keyboard is a device that allows users to input letters or numbers into different applications or programs. It consists of a set of keys, each representing a specific character or function. Users can press the keys on the keyboard to enter text, commands, or data into various software or hardware systems. This input method is essential for interacting with computers and other electronic devices, making the keyboard the correct answer in this case.

5. What should you do if someone online asks you not to tell your parents about them?

Explanation

It is important to tell your parents straight away if someone online asks you not to tell them about them. This is because it could be a potential danger or a sign of inappropriate behavior. Your parents can help ensure your safety and guide you on how to handle the situation appropriately. Keeping silent or obeying their request could put you at risk and prevent you from getting the necessary support and protection. Asking the poster why may not be sufficient as they may not provide truthful or reliable information.

6. Output devices are things we use to get information OUT of a computer.

Explanation

Output devices are indeed used to get information out of a computer. These devices allow us to receive or view the processed data, such as the monitor displaying visual information, speakers playing audio, or printers producing hard copies of documents. Therefore, the statement "Output devices are things we use to get information OUT of a computer" is correct.

7. The physical parts, which you can see and touch, are called hardware.

Explanation

The statement is stating that the physical parts that are visible and can be touched are referred to as hardware. This is true because hardware refers to the tangible components of a computer system, such as the monitor, keyboard, mouse, and other physical devices. These components can be physically observed and interacted with, distinguishing them from software, which consists of intangible programs and instructions.

9. Things we use to put information INTO a computer.

Explanation

Input devices are used to put information into a computer. Output devices, such as monitors or printers, are used to display or produce information from the computer. DVD-Rom is a type of storage device, not an input device. Therefore, the correct answer is input devices.

10. Word, Excel, Power Point and Access are Operating Systems.

Explanation

The given statement is false. Word, Excel, Power Point, and Access are not operating systems. They are software applications that are part of the Microsoft Office suite. Operating systems, on the other hand, are the software that manages computer hardware and software resources and provides services for computer programs to run. Examples of operating systems include Windows, macOS, and Linux.
